Mother of Three Absconds After Husband Plots to Circumcise Children

Mother of Three Absconds After Husband Plots to Circumcise Children

A mum has fled her home with her three children in an attempt to prevent them from getting circumcised according to the tradition of her husband.

According to VanguardVictoria Ijeoma Akinsanya fled her Festac town, Lagos residence to an unknown destination leaving her aged mother Celestina Njoku behind.

Victoria who hails from Imo State got married to a Yoruba man, Akinsanya from Itoko in Abeokuta, Ogun State and they have three kids together.

According to the custom of the family of Akinsanya, it is a compulsory rite to initiate their male child and circumcise the female child.

A reliable family source stated that failure to carry out these rites may cause death and premature deaths in the family.

Unknown to Victoria, some old women suspected to be members of her husband’s family visited their home to carry out the rites but met the wrath of Victoria.

The Akinsanya family at various times visited and appealed to Victoria’s relatives who lived at Akinbami area of Festac town, to get Victoria and her children circumcised according to their tradition.

As the pressure was becoming unbearable, Victoria took her children and fled for their lives.

It was gathered that the Akinsanya family said it is a taboo for any member of their family to remain uncircumcised and as a result, Victoria and her children could risk having ancestral problems for disobeying their deity.

At the moment, Victoria and her children’s whereabouts are unknown.

Her mother was unhappy about the development.

Victoria’s mom says she was not in support of the tradition and had reported the matter to appropriate authorities.

Njoku Ifeanyi, Victoria’s younger brother, said problem started on April 2nd, when some elderly women in the family visited their home over circumcision but they were warned by his mum to stop the inquiries and this generated a heated argument.

Ifeanyi explained: “The visiting family members left in annoyance, and on the same day when I was going out, I was attacked by some hoodlums but I retaliated and it took the efforts of some passers-by to quell the incident.

”Mrs Celestina said she was of the opinion that the culprits were from her in-laws because there had been several attacks on her daughter Mrs Victoria Ijeoma Akinsanya before she absconded, “but the husband’s family has denied this.”
